Figure 2 shows our images of services that robots provide people at shelters or nursing homes.
The left handwritten figure shows that a robot attends a visitor at a door in place of a person in a bed.
The visitor communicates with the person in a bed through PCs, one PC is mounted on the robot and the other is by the bed.
The right handwritten figure shows that a robot cleans an indicated area.
The elderly use gestures or deictic words such as here, to express their indications.
The communication style is convenient for people; however, it is a difficult task for robots available commercially to understand what people expect robots to do.
